Hypertension, commonly known as high blood pressure, is a prevalent condition that affects many individuals in the United States. It can lead to severe health complications if not properly managed. Access to healthcare services and regular medical check-ups are vital for individuals with Hypertension to monitor their condition and prevent any potential risks.
